The American Sports Institute is creating a tuition-free,
privately-funded, sport and wellness-based school
that will generate high academic and high health
and fitness scores, and a love of learning for
all its students, including those from disadvantaged
backgrounds. The Arete School will eventually
become a teacher training center for educators
in the United States and internationally, and
will be a model for California’s and America’s public schools.

A two-semester, interdisciplinary middle and high school academic course that enables students to apply the positive aspects of sport culture and the fundamentals of athletic mastery to their academic, physical, and personal pursuits.

A program for elementary-age students that incorporates the positive aspects of sport culture into the classroom setting to improve attitudes and skills in concentration, self-discipline, personal presence and leadership, responsibility, respect for surroundings, empathy and respect for others, and acting individually and as an integral member of a group.

A 25 to 35-minute daily (or several times a week)
program for middle and high school students that
incorporates the positive aspects of sport culture
into the academic setting to improve attitudes
and skills in concentration, self-discipline,
personal presence and leadership, responsibility,
respect for surroundings, empathy and respect
for others, and acting individually and as an
integral member of a group.
